r1197 - in zope-textindexng3/trunk (9 files)

Fabio Tranchitella kobold at alioth.debian.org
Thu Mar 6 15:46:30 UTC 2008


    Date: Thursday, March 6, 2008 @ 15:46:29
  Author: kobold
Revision: 1197

[svn-inject] Applying Debian modifications to trunk

Added:
  zope-textindexng3/trunk/debian/
  zope-textindexng3/trunk/debian/changelog
  zope-textindexng3/trunk/debian/compat
  zope-textindexng3/trunk/debian/control
  zope-textindexng3/trunk/debian/copyright
  zope-textindexng3/trunk/debian/dzproduct
  zope-textindexng3/trunk/debian/pycompat
  zope-textindexng3/trunk/debian/rules
  zope-textindexng3/trunk/debian/separator


Property changes on: zope-textindexng3/trunk/debian
___________________________________________________________________
Name: mergeWithUpstream
   + 1

Added: zope-textindexng3/trunk/debian/changelog
===================================================================
--- zope-textindexng3/trunk/debian/changelog	                        (rev 0)
+++ zope-textindexng3/trunk/debian/changelog	2008-03-06 15:46:29 UTC (rev 1197)
@@ -0,0 +1,129 @@
+zope-textindexng3 (1:3.2.1-1) unstable; urgency=low
+
+  * Upload of TextIndexNG3.
+
+ -- Fabio Tranchitella <kobold at debian.org>  Mon, 22 Oct 2007 15:13:54 +0200
+
+zope-textindexng2 (1:2.2.0-5) unstable; urgency=low
+
+  * debian/dzproduct: capitalize the name of the product.
+    (Closes: #389388)
+
+ -- Fabio Tranchitella <kobold at debian.org>  Wed,  4 Oct 2006 20:20:51 +0200
+
+zope-textindexng2 (1:2.2.0-4) unstable; urgency=low
+
+  * debian/dzproduct: added the package field. (Closes: #384828)
+  * debian/rules, debian/control: clean-up and changes for the python
+    transition.
+
+ -- Fabio Tranchitella <kobold at debian.org>  Tue, 29 Aug 2006 13:53:42 +0200
+
+zope-textindexng2 (1:2.2.0-3) unstable; urgency=low
+
+  * Fixed broken NMU, TextindexNG does not work with Zope 3
+    Really Closes: #368184
+    Closes: #370775
+  * Removed debian/postinst because zope-common takes over
+    this job
+  * debian/rules: Added dh_installzope and replaced manual
+    copy commands
+  * Added debian/dzhandle
+  * Removed "Suggests: python2.3-optik" that is not available
+    any more
+  * Standards-Version: 3.7.2 (no changes necessary)
+  * Switch to debhelper 5 (debian/compat: 5)
+  * Split into all and any package to enable dh_zope correct
+    handling of architecture independant parts according to
+    discussion on pkg-zope list
+
+ -- Andreas Tille <tille at debian.org>  Mon, 10 Jul 2006 16:42:54 +0200
+
+zope-textindexng2 (1:2.2.0-2.1) unstable; urgency=high
+
+  * Non-maintainer upload.
+  * Update zope dependency to zope3 (Closes: #368184).
+
+ -- Luk Claes <luk at debian.org>  Tue,  6 Jun 2006 20:09:44 +0200
+
+zope-textindexng2 (1:2.2.0-2) unstable; urgency=low
+
+  * Standards-Version: 3.6.2
+  * setup.py: ext_args = ['-O2']
+    Closes: #325562
+
+ -- Andreas Tille <tille at debian.org>  Tue, 30 Aug 2005 13:33:25 +0200
+
+zope-textindexng2 (1:2.2.0-1) unstable; urgency=low
+
+  * New upstream version
+  * Depends: zope2.7
+    --> (Build-)Depends python2.3-* instead of python2.2-*
+  * Standards-Version: 3.6.2.1 (no changes necessary)
+  * Depends: debconf | debconf-2.0, ${misc:Depends}
+  * Uploaders: Debian Zope team <pkg-zope-developers at lists.alioth.debian.org>
+  * debian/install: s/python2.2/python2.3/g
+
+ -- Andreas Tille <tille at debian.org>  Sun,  7 Aug 2005 14:18:44 +0200
+
+zope-textindexng2 (1:2.0.8-5) unstable; urgency=low
+
+  * Use distutils properly to prevent problems on amd64
+    (thanks to Seo Sanghyeon <tinuviel at sparcs.kaist.ac.kr> for the patch)
+    Closes: #294506
+  * Start description sysnopsis with lowercase letter
+
+ -- Andreas Tille <tille at debian.org>  Thu, 10 Feb 2005 11:58:30 +0100
+
+zope-textindexng2 (1:2.0.8-4) unstable; urgency=low
+
+  * Fix typo in xls converter (Thanks to Renaud Duhaut <rd at duhaut.com>)
+    Closes: #286839
+
+ -- Andreas Tille <tille at debian.org>  Fri, 24 Dec 2004 15:03:01 +0100
+
+zope-textindexng2 (1:2.0.8-3) unstable; urgency=low
+
+  * set depends_on='ppthtml' in converters/ppt.py
+    Closes: #280141
+  * Standards-Version: 3.6.1.1
+    (no changes required)
+  * Added comment to README.Debian why the new TextIndexNG2 version
+    is not yet packaged (depends from Zope 2.7)
+
+ -- Andreas Tille <tille at debian.org>  Mon,  8 Nov 2004 10:17:09 +0100
+
+zope-textindexng2 (1:2.0.8-1) unstable; urgency=low
+
+  * New upstream version
+    Closes: #261231
+  * Perform TextCases in postinst scripts if zope-textcase is installed
+
+ -- Andreas Tille <tille at debian.org>  Tue, 10 Aug 2004 14:37:16 +0200
+
+zope-textindexng2 (1:2.0.7-1) unstable; urgency=low
+
+  * New upstream version
+  * Added get-orig-source target to debian/rules
+  * Added lintian.overrides
+  * Fixed description OpenOffice -> OpenOffice.org
+    Closes: #254050
+
+ -- Andreas Tille <tille at debian.org>  Sat, 12 Jun 2004 22:39:08 +0200
+
+zope-textindexng2 (2.05-1) unstable; urgency=low
+
+  * New upstream version
+  * Fixed debian/rules to build binary-arch target instead of
+    binary-indep
+    closes: #229405
+
+ -- Andreas Tille <tille at debian.org>  Sun, 25 Jan 2004 10:09:58 +0100
+
+zope-textindexng2 (2.0.2-1) unstable; urgency=low
+
+  * Initial release
+    closes: #219942 
+
+ -- Andreas Tille <tille at debian.org>  Mon, 10 Nov 2003 12:55:28 +0100
+

Added: zope-textindexng3/trunk/debian/compat
===================================================================
--- zope-textindexng3/trunk/debian/compat	                        (rev 0)
+++ zope-textindexng3/trunk/debian/compat	2008-03-06 15:46:29 UTC (rev 1197)
@@ -0,0 +1 @@
+5

Added: zope-textindexng3/trunk/debian/control
===================================================================
--- zope-textindexng3/trunk/debian/control	                        (rev 0)
+++ zope-textindexng3/trunk/debian/control	2008-03-06 15:46:29 UTC (rev 1197)
@@ -0,0 +1,38 @@
+Source: zope-textindexng3
+Section: web
+Priority: extra
+Maintainer: Debian/Ubuntu Zope team <pkg-zope-developers at lists.alioth.debian.org>
+Uploaders: Andreas Tille <tille at debian.org>, Fabio Tranchitella <kobold at debian.org>
+Standards-Version: 3.7.2
+Build-Depends: debhelper (>= 5.0.37.2), python-all-dev, python (>= 2.3.5-7), python-central (>= 0.5)
+Build-Depends-Indep: zope-debhelper
+XS-Python-Version: all
+
+Package: zope-textindexng3
+Architecture: all
+Depends: ${zope:Depends}, zope-textindexng3-lib (>= ${source:Version}), zope-textindexng3-lib (<< ${source:Version}.1~), xpdf-utils, gs-common, wv, catdoc, ppthtml, debconf | debconf-2.0
+Description: full text index for Zope objects
+ TextIndexNG3 is the reimplementation of the well-known TextIndexNG product for
+ Zope 2 using Zope 3 technologies. It is a full text index for Zope objects and
+ is the most feature-complete solution for full text indexing under Zope.  The
+ current implementation runs out-of-the-box on Zope 2 (in combination with
+ Five).
+ .
+ Supported Formats: HTML, PDF, Postscript, WinWord, PowerPoint, OpenOffice.org
+ .
+ This package contains the binary libraries.
+
+Package: zope-textindexng3-lib
+Architecture: any
+Depends: ${python:Depends}
+XB-Python-Version: ${python:Versions}
+Description: full text index for Zope objects
+ TextIndexNG3 is the reimplementation of the well-known TextIndexNG product for
+ Zope 2 using Zope 3 technologies. It is a full text index for Zope objects and
+ is the most feature-complete solution for full text indexing under Zope.  The
+ current implementation runs out-of-the-box on Zope 2 (in combination with
+ Five).
+ .
+ Supported Formats: HTML, PDF, Postscript, WinWord, PowerPoint, OpenOffice.org
+ .
+ This package contains the binary libraries.

Added: zope-textindexng3/trunk/debian/copyright
===================================================================
--- zope-textindexng3/trunk/debian/copyright	                        (rev 0)
+++ zope-textindexng3/trunk/debian/copyright	2008-03-06 15:46:29 UTC (rev 1197)
@@ -0,0 +1,38 @@
+This package was debianized by Fabio Tranchitella <kobold at kobold.it> on
+Mon, 22 Oct 2007 15:40:01 +0200. It is based on the package zope-textindexng2,
+which was debianized by Andreas Tille <tille at debian.org> on Tue,  28 Oct 2003
+10:43:55 +0200
+
+Homepage:
+   http://opensource.zopyx.com/software/textindexng3
+   
+Download URL:
+
+Upstream Author: 
+   Copyright (c) 2007 Andreas Jung <andreas at andreas-jung.com>
+
+License: 
+         
+TextIndexNG is designed and written by Andreas Jung and published under the
+Zope Public License ZPL (http://www.zope.org/Resources/ZPL)
+(See below in this file.)
+
+The following parts of TextIndexNG are not covered by the ZPL:
+
+  - The python Levenshtein extension sources are Copyright (C) by David Necas
+    (Yeti) <yeti at physics.muni.cz> and published under the GPL.
+    (See /usr/share/common-licenses/GPL)
+
+  - The Snowball stemmer sources are (C) Dr. Martin Porter and published under
+    the MIT Public License. (See below in this file)
+
+  - The file /src/textindexng/parsers/lex.py is (C) David M. Beazley
+    (dave at dabeaz.com) and published under the GPL license.
+    (See /usr/share/common-licenses/GPL)
+
+  - zopyx.txng3.splitter uses parts of the "libdict" packages. The package is published
+    under the Berkely License.  Copyright (C) 2001 Farooq Mela. All rights reserved.
+    (See below in this file)
+
+  - converters/stripogramm is Copyright (c) 2001 Chris Withers and published
+    under the MIT license. (See below in this file)

Added: zope-textindexng3/trunk/debian/dzproduct
===================================================================
--- zope-textindexng3/trunk/debian/dzproduct	                        (rev 0)
+++ zope-textindexng3/trunk/debian/dzproduct	2008-03-06 15:46:29 UTC (rev 1197)
@@ -0,0 +1,3 @@
+Name: TextIndexNG3
+Package: zope-textindexng3
+ZopeVersions: >= 2.10

Added: zope-textindexng3/trunk/debian/pycompat
===================================================================
--- zope-textindexng3/trunk/debian/pycompat	                        (rev 0)
+++ zope-textindexng3/trunk/debian/pycompat	2008-03-06 15:46:29 UTC (rev 1197)
@@ -0,0 +1 @@
+2

Added: zope-textindexng3/trunk/debian/rules
===================================================================
--- zope-textindexng3/trunk/debian/rules	                        (rev 0)
+++ zope-textindexng3/trunk/debian/rules	2008-03-06 15:46:29 UTC (rev 1197)
@@ -0,0 +1,88 @@
+#!/usr/bin/make -f
+# debian/rules for zope-textindexng3 using dh_installzope
+# Andreas Tille <tille at debian.org>  Tue,  1 Apr 2003 10:43:55 +0200
+# GPL
+VERSION=3.2.1
+
+export DH_PYCENTRAL=nomove
+PYVERS=$(shell pyversions -r debian/control)
+
+upstreamshort=TextIndexNG
+upstreamname=$(upstreamshort)3
+pkg=zope-textindexng3
+
+build: build-stamp
+build-stamp:
+	dh_testdir
+	cd extension_modules; for python in $(PYVERS); do \
+		$$python setup.py install --home build; \
+		mv build/lib/python build/lib/$$python; \
+	done
+	touch build-stamp
+
+clean:
+	dh_testdir
+	dh_testroot
+	rm -fr build-stamp extension_modules/build
+	dh_clean
+
+install-arch: build-stamp
+	dh_testdir
+	dh_testroot
+	dh_clean -k -a
+	dh_installdirs -a
+	for python in $(PYVERS); do \
+		mkdir -p debian/$(pkg)-lib/usr/lib/$$python/site-packages; \
+		cp -axp extension_modules/build/lib/$$python/* debian/$(pkg)-lib/usr/lib/$$python/site-packages; \
+	done
+
+install-indep: build-stamp
+	dh_testdir
+	dh_testroot
+	dh_clean -k -i
+	dh_installdirs -i
+	dh_installzope -p $(pkg) -X debian -X src -X tests -X build -X .bzr -X extension_modules -X LICENSE.txt .
+
+binary-indep: build install-indep
+	dh_testdir
+	dh_testroot
+	dh_install -i
+	dh_installdocs -i doc/README.txt
+	# Add the different licenses to Copyright file
+	cat debian/separator >> debian/$(pkg)/usr/share/doc/$(pkg)/copyright
+	cat extension_modules/zopyx/txng3/splitter/LICENSE >> debian/$(pkg)/usr/share/doc/$(pkg)/copyright
+	cat debian/separator >> debian/$(pkg)/usr/share/doc/$(pkg)/copyright
+	cat src/textindexng/converters/stripogram/license.txt >> debian/$(pkg)/usr/share/doc/$(pkg)/copyright
+	dh_installchangelogs -i
+	dh_link -i
+	dh_strip -i
+	dh_compress -i
+	dh_installexamples -i
+	dh_fixperms -i
+	dh_installdeb -i
+	dh_shlibdeps -i
+	dh_gencontrol -i
+	dh_md5sums -i
+	dh_builddeb -i
+
+binary-arch: build install-arch
+	dh_testdir
+	dh_testroot
+	dh_install -a
+	dh_installdocs -a
+	dh_installchangelogs -a
+	dh_pycentral -a
+	dh_link -a
+	dh_strip -a
+	dh_compress -a
+	dh_installexamples -a
+	dh_fixperms -a
+	dh_installdeb -a
+	dh_shlibdeps -a
+	dh_gencontrol -a
+	dh_md5sums -a
+	dh_builddeb -a
+
+binary: binary-indep binary-arch
+.PHONY: build clean binary-indep binary-arch binary install
+


Property changes on: zope-textindexng3/trunk/debian/rules
___________________________________________________________________
Name: svn:executable
   + *

Added: zope-textindexng3/trunk/debian/separator
===================================================================
--- zope-textindexng3/trunk/debian/separator	                        (rev 0)
+++ zope-textindexng3/trunk/debian/separator	2008-03-06 15:46:29 UTC (rev 1197)
@@ -0,0 +1,3 @@
+
+-----------------------------------------------------------------------------
+




More information about the pkg-zope-commits mailing list